M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- Next month, you can walk to raise awareness and help move us toward a world without type 1 diabetes. CBS 58 was joined by Corinne Merten and Jessica and Sage Yoder to tell us more about the Breakthrough T1D Walk in Milwaukee, taking place Oct. 18.
